What to check before choosing a pre-war building near the Q25 bus in Kew Gardens Hills

  • Confirm the commute reality: the Q25 route can change how long it takes you to reach work, schools, or connections during different times of day.
  • Verify building condition details directly (heat/hot water notes, recent repairs, elevator status, and any pest or maintenance history) even when the building is flagged as pre-war.
  • Check apartment-specific lease terms: rent amount, lease length, guarantor requirements, and move-in timing can vary within the same building.
  • Look for practical fee items before applying: broker fee expectations, security deposit amount, and whether any move-in costs are added to the monthly rent.
  • Use the tenant Q&A to prep questions for management about parking, laundry access, package handling, and how requests are handled day to day.
